About Biba Village

Biba is a village in Chikhaldara tehsil in district of Amravati, Maharashtra, India. As per the data provided by Census of India in 2011, total population of Biba was 1,314 which includes 662 males and 652 females. Biba covers 634 ha area. Pincode of Biba is N/A.
